移动端IM工具迎来交互革新:群接龙与语音输入双功能深度解析

一、功能演进背景:从基础通讯到协作工具的升级

在移动端即时通讯工具的发展历程中,功能迭代始终围绕用户核心需求展开。早期产品聚焦于点对点消息传递,随着企业级市场的崛起,群组管理、文件共享等协作功能逐渐成为标配。近期某主流IM工具推出的群接龙与语音输入功能,标志着产品从”通讯工具”向”协作平台”的关键转型。

群接龙功能解决了团队协作中的两大痛点:信息收集的碎片化与统计的耗时性。传统方式下,组织者需要在群内反复提醒成员填写信息,再通过人工整理生成表格,整个流程平均耗时超过30分钟。而接龙功能通过结构化模板与自动化统计,将这一过程压缩至3分钟以内。

语音输入的升级则回应了移动场景下的输入效率问题。根据用户行为数据分析,在移动端使用拼音输入的平均速度为28字/分钟,而语音输入可达150字/分钟。此次升级不仅提升了识别准确率,更通过上下文理解优化了专业术语的识别效果。

二、群接龙功能技术实现解析

1. 架构设计

系统采用分层架构设计,自下而上分为数据存储层、业务逻辑层与交互展示层:

  • 数据存储层:使用关系型数据库存储接龙模板与用户提交数据,通过索引优化提升查询效率
  • 业务逻辑层:实现模板生成、数据校验、状态管理等核心功能,采用状态机模式管理接龙生命周期
  • 交互展示层:提供可视化模板编辑器与数据统计看板,支持实时更新与导出功能
  1. # 状态机实现示例
  2. class HandoverStateMachine:
  3. def __init__(self):
  4. self.states = {
  5. 'draft': ['publish'],
  6. 'published': ['collect', 'close'],
  7. 'collected': ['export', 'close']
  8. }
  9. self.current_state = 'draft'
  10. def transition(self, action):
  11. if action in self.states[self.current_state]:
  12. self.current_state = action
  13. return True
  14. return False

2. 核心功能实现

  • 模板定制:支持自定义字段类型(文本/数字/单选/多选),通过JSON Schema定义数据结构
  • 智能校验:对必填字段、数据格式进行实时校验,错误提示准确率达98%
  • 自动化统计:采用MapReduce模式处理提交数据,百万级数据统计耗时<2秒
  • 权限控制:基于RBAC模型实现模板编辑、数据查看等权限管理

3. 性能优化方案

  • 数据库分表策略:按接龙ID哈希分表,避免单表数据量过大
  • 缓存机制:使用Redis缓存热门模板与统计结果,命中率超过90%
  • 异步处理:数据导出等耗时操作采用消息队列异步处理

三、语音输入功能技术突破

1. 语音识别引擎升级

新一代引擎采用端到端深度学习架构,相比传统混合模型具有三大优势:

  • 上下文理解:通过LSTM网络捕捉上下文信息,专业术语识别准确率提升40%
  • 多方言支持:训练数据覆盖8种主流方言,方言识别准确率达85%
  • 实时性优化:采用流式识别技术,首字响应时间缩短至300ms

2. 交互设计创新

  • 动态修正:在语音输入过程中实时显示识别结果,支持手动修正错误
  • 标点预测:通过NLP模型自动添加标点符号,减少后期编辑工作量
  • 多模态输入:支持语音与键盘输入混合使用,满足复杂场景需求

3. 典型应用场景

场景类型 使用方式 效率提升
会议记录 实时转写讨论内容 75%
任务分配 语音描述任务要求自动生成文本 60%
紧急通知 语音输入快速生成群公告 80%
多语言协作 中英文混合输入自动识别 50%

四、开发者实践指南

1. 功能集成方案

对于希望在自有应用中实现类似功能的开发者,建议采用模块化集成方案:

  1. 语音识别模块:接入主流语音识别API,处理音频流传输与结果返回
  2. 接龙引擎:基于开源框架搭建核心逻辑,重点实现模板管理与数据统计
  3. UI组件库:使用跨平台组件库实现统一交互体验

2. 测试验证要点

  • 兼容性测试:覆盖主流Android/iOS版本与设备型号
  • 压力测试:模拟千人级并发接龙场景,验证系统稳定性
  • 异常测试:测试网络中断、设备旋转等异常场景下的恢复能力

3. 性能监控指标

建议建立以下监控指标体系:

  • 语音识别:首字响应时间、识别准确率、方言覆盖率
  • 群接龙:模板加载时间、数据提交成功率、统计延迟
  • 系统资源:CPU占用率、内存使用量、网络流量

五、未来演进方向

随着AI技术的持续发展,即时通讯工具的协作功能将呈现三大趋势:

  1. 智能化升级:通过NLP技术实现接龙内容的自动分类与标签生成
  2. 场景化拓展:开发行业专属模板库,满足教育、医疗等垂直领域需求
  3. 跨平台协同:实现移动端与桌面端的数据同步与操作接力

对于开发者而言,把握这些趋势需要重点关注:

  • 轻量化AI模型部署技术
  • 多端数据同步协议设计
  • 隐私保护增强技术

此次功能升级不仅提升了用户体验,更重新定义了移动端协作的标准。通过结构化数据收集与智能化输入方式的结合,某主流IM工具为企业用户提供了更高效的协作解决方案。开发者在借鉴这些设计时,应重点关注底层技术架构的扩展性与业务逻辑的灵活性,以适应不同场景下的定制化需求。